Goals and Objectives:
The primary goal of the China Node is to expand the AMTA community to Chinese antenna professionals who have yet to participate in the AMTA Annual Symposium or AMTA-convened sessions at the EUCAP Conference. It will engage these members via Node-led initiatives, such as an annual one-day workshop.
The Node will prioritize industry-academia-government collaboration, focusing on facility sharing and best practices in antenna measurements—including round-robin inter-laboratory comparisons, traceability, uncertainty reporting, and site validation.
It aims to rapidly establish itself as a trusted reference hub for individuals and organizations in the Node region with interests in antenna measurements.
The Node plans to organize local events to capture, showcase, and advance the latest developments in antenna measurements.
It will document regional antenna measurement activities and share insights by submitting papers to the AMTA Symposium and AMTA-convened sessions at EUCAP.
Meetings
The Node will host an annual one-day workshop centered on antenna measurements. Where feasible, the workshop will be co-hosted alongside major national events or conferences. Global AMTA experts will be invited to participate, fostering international knowledge exchange.
